A versatile and ingenious little Danish teak dressing table… which could also double as a desk!
Designed by Svend Aage Madsen in the 1950s, the sides and top flip open to reveal a mirrored and teak-lined interior with various storage areas, while its clean lines and stripped-down design give it an awesome, modernist look.
This simple yet beautiful piece of furniture comes very good vintage condition and is complete with the designer’s stamp on its underside.
H69cm x W90cm x D45cm
(W130cm extended, knee height 61cm, knee width 47cm minimum)
Very good vintage condition – completely sturdy with minor signs of age and some foxing to the original mirror glass.
